Output d0899897fc8f2b84068915f19d61d74f8c56ec2c63e1fc7ba490d9c44eb1cc9b:13

value
15136317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ba8fb0810aa86a2ba545bf62f656fc12366e3d OP_EQUAL
address
31rA6Ew9pxxj5kJgXqQdRxgAL1tqnZrmDi
transaction
d0899897fc8f2b84068915f19d61d74f8c56ec2c63e1fc7ba490d9c44eb1cc9b
spent
true